Dr. Charles W. Mango is a board-certified ophthalmologist trained at Cornell University - New York Presbyterian Hospital in New York City. He has completed a two year fellowship in vitreoretinal disease and surgery at the Jules Stein Eye Institute - University of California Los Angeles.


Dr. Mango has a teaching position at Cornell University - New York Presbyterian Hospital as a Clinical Assistant Professor of Ophthalmology where he enjoys teaching the resident and fellow physicians.


Dr. Mango has published in major scientific journals and is actively involved in scientific research projects and clinical trials.  He has authored multiple textbook chapters and is currently a section editor of the Retina Times, the official publication of the American Society of Retina Specialists.


Dr. Mango enjoys hiking, skiing, and traveling in his free time.
